I have partially built LLVM with MinGW-w64 8.1.0 (some llvm shared libs needed, 
not clang and stdlib). 

For experimenting with build I personally recommend using ninja instead of 
mingw32-make because it allows resuming without rebuilding everything from 
scratch if I added a linker flag into a CMake cache variable.

> So I think it would have been better to select the Mingw-w64 x86_64-win32-seh 
> or even x86_64-win32-sjlj version instead?

I guess, no. If something somewhere uses std::thread and other threading stuff, 
you will have problems since "win32" versions of the toolchain lack it since it 
is implemented upon pthreads.
